Exactly How Roof Ventilation Works



Effective roof ventilation depends on the natural movement of air to develop an equilibrium in between consumption and exhaust. When you install vents, you're essentially enabling fresh air to enter your attic while enabling hot, stagnant air to get away. This process helps regulate temperature level and dampness levels, protecting against issues like mold growth and roof covering damages.

Intake vents, typically discovered at the eaves, reel in great air from outdoors. On the other hand,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, let hot air surge and leave. The distinction in temperature creates an all-natural air flow, referred to as the pile result. As cozy air increases, it creates a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the lower vents.

To maximize this system, you need to guarantee that the consumption and exhaust vents are properly sized and positioned. If the consumption is restricted, you will not accomplish the wanted ventilation.

Furthermore, insufficient exhaust can trap heat and wetness, leading to prospective damages.

Trick Setup Factors To Consider



When mounting roof air flow, a number of crucial considerations can make or damage your system's effectiveness. Initially, you need to examine your roofing's design. The pitch, form, and products all affect airflow and ventilation choice. See to it to select vents that fit your roofing system kind and neighborhood climate problems.

Next off, consider the positioning of your vents. Preferably, you'll want a balanced system with intake and exhaust vents positioned for optimal air movement. Location consumption vents low on the roofing system and exhaust vents near the peak to encourage a natural flow of air. This arrangement aids avoid moisture build-up and promotes power performance.


Don't forget about insulation. Correct insulation in your attic prevents heat from getting away and keeps your home comfortable. Make certain that insulation does not block your vents, as this can impede air flow.

Last but not least, consider upkeep. Pick air flow systems that are simple to accessibility for cleansing and assessment. Regular maintenance guarantees your system remains to operate efficiently in time.
